Why Wi-Fi Speed Feels Slow in Bangladesh Homes

Even with a 20–50 Mbps internet package, many users get only 30–60% real speed on Wi-Fi.
The reason is rarely the ISP alone.

From real diagnostics across Dhaka, Chattogram, and Sylhet homes, the main causes are:

  • Incorrect router channel and bandwidth

  • Poor router placement

  • Outdated firmware

  • Wrong frequency band usage

  • High signal interference (2.4 GHz congestion)

Before blaming your ISP, you must optimize your router properly.

How to Increase Wi-Fi Speed Router Settings (Step-by-Step)

This section directly fulfils the search intent “how to increase wifi speed router”.

1. Change Wi-Fi Channel Manually (Most Important Fix)

In Bangladesh, 2.4 GHz channels 1–11 are overcrowded.
Routers on “Auto” often pick bad channels.

Best practice (tested):

  • Use Channel 1, 6, or 11 only

  • Avoid overlapping channels like 3, 4, 8

📊 Real result:
Changing channel alone can improve speed by 15–35% in apartments.

2. Set Channel Bandwidth Correctly

Wrong bandwidth reduces performance.

Band

Recommended Bandwidth

2.4 GHz

20 MHz

5 GHz

40 MHz or 80 MHz

Using 40 MHz on 2.4 GHz increases interference and packet loss.

3. Enable 5 GHz Band (If Available)

If your router supports dual-band, always use 5 GHz for:

  • Gaming

  • Streaming

  • Office work

Speed difference (average):

  • 2.4 GHz → 20–40 Mbps

  • 5 GHz → 80–300 Mbps (short range)

Improve Wi-Fi Signal at Home Using Proper Router Placement

Many Bangladeshi homes place routers incorrectly.

Router Placement for Best Signal (Practical Rules)

Place your router:

  • At 1.2–1.5 meters height

  • In the center of your home

  • Away from walls, metal, and aquariums

  • At least 3 feet away from TV, fridge, microwave

❌ Avoid:

  • Under tables

  • Inside cabinets

  • Near concrete pillars

📈 Correct placement improves signal strength by 20–40%.

How to Make Wi-Fi Faster for Gaming (Low Ping Setup)

This section targets wifi router settings for gaming.

Gaming-Optimised Router Settings

Enable these settings:

  • QoS (Quality of Service) → Prioritise gaming device

  • Disable WMM Power Save

  • NAT Type: Open

  • MTU Size: 1492 (PPPoE)

Average ping improvement:

  • Before: 35–60 ms

  • After: 18–30 ms (fiber users)

Optimize Router for Streaming (4K & IPTV)

Streaming fails due to buffer underruns, not raw speed.

Best Settings for Streaming

  • Use 5 GHz only

  • Enable IGMP Snooping

  • Disable bandwidth-hungry background apps

  • Use wired LAN for smart TV when possible

Required speed (real values):

Quality

Required Speed

1080p

5–8 Mbps

4K UHD

25–30 Mbps

How to Fix Slow Wi-Fi Connection (Advanced Fixes)

This section directly matches how to fix slow wifi connection intent.

1. Update Router Firmware

Outdated firmware causes:

  • Speed drops

  • Random disconnects

  • Security risks

Check updates every 6 months.

2. Change DNS for Faster Browsing

Recommended DNS for Bangladesh:

  • Google DNS → 8.8.8.8 / 8.8.4.4

  • Cloudflare → 1.1.1.1 / 1.0.0.1

DNS change improves page load time by 10–25%.

3. Secure Your Wi-Fi Network

Use:

  • WPA2-AES or WPA3

  • Disable WPS

  • Strong password (12+ characters)

Open networks reduce speed due to unknown device usage.

Frequently Asked Questions (People Also Ask)

What are the best router settings for faster Wi-Fi speed in Bangladesh?

Use channel 1, 6, or 11 on 2.4 GHz, enable 5 GHz, set 20 MHz bandwidth, update firmware, and place the router centrally. These settings improve real-world speed by up to 40%.

Does router placement really affect Wi-Fi speed?

Yes. Poor placement can reduce speed by 30–50% due to signal blockage and interference.

Which Wi-Fi band is best for gaming in Bangladesh?

5 GHz is best for gaming because it has lower interference and better latency, especially with fiber internet.

Why is my Wi-Fi slow but LAN is fast?

This usually indicates channel congestion, interference, or outdated router settings—not ISP issues.

How often should I restart my router?

Restart once every 7–14 days to clear cache and refresh connections.
